45 CFR 400.220: Counting time-eligibility of refugees.

A State may calculate the time-eligibility of a refugee under this part in either of the following ways:

(a) On the basis of calendar months, in which case the month of arrival in the United States must count as the first month; or

(b) On the basis of the actual date of arrival, in which case each month will be counted from that specific date.
